#2e4b98 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2e4b98 is composed of 18% red, 29.4%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 69.7% cyan, 50.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 223.6 degrees, a saturation of 53.5% and a lightness of 38.8%. #2e4b98 color hex could be obtained by blending #5c96ff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#333399.

● #2e4b98 color description : Dark moderate blue.
#2e4b98 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2e4b98 has RGB values of R:46, G:75,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0.7, M:0.51, Y:0,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 3034008.

Shades and Tints of #2e4b98
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000101 is the darkest color, while #f1f4f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#2e4b98
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5c606a is the less saturated color, while #0036c6 is the most saturated one.
